java.text.Format 类的 AttributedCharacterIterator formatToCharacterIterator(Object obj)方法
它应该可以格式化一个对象的(自己写的一个类)这里要注意什么问题呀?People people = new People();
formatToCharacterIterator(people) 为什么出现问题呀?我就想 格式化一个自己写的类的一个对象,得到一个AttributedCharacterIterator类型的对象。 请大家指点,应该怎样做呀?

解决方案 »

  1.   

    什么错误呢
    NullPointerException - 如果 obj 为 null。 
    IllegalArgumentException - 如果该 Format 无法格式化给定的对象。
      

  2.   

    Format 是一个抽象类,而 formatToCharacterIterator 不是一个static方法。所以需要用Format的子类实例化一个Format对象来调用这个方法。
      

  3.   

    我就想 格式化一个自己写的类的一个对象,得到一个AttributedCharacterIterator类型的对象。 请大家指点,应该怎样做呀?